This event will highlight ways to develop partnership working and help your museum or archive become part of the long-term picture in children and young people’s provision.  

Working in partnerships

MULTI-AGENCY WORKING

Date: Monday 8 March 2010
Times: 10.00am-3.00pm
Venue: Great North Museum, Newcastle - http://www.twmuseums.org.uk/greatnorthmuseum/

For: Cultural educators and children's workforce professionals

Event description: We are being encouraged to work together, with organisations that have different and sometimes complementary agendas. This workshops shares practical techniques and approaches to working in partnerships with other organisations and individuals in order to achieve a successful project or event.

Leadership Development Workshop

EFFECTIVE COMMUNICATION & ENGAGEMENT

Date: Wednesday 24 March 2010
Times: 9.15am-4.30pm
Location: Newcastle

For: Museum/archive and other cultural educators and children's workforce professionals who are mid-career or 'emerging' leaders within the North East region.

Event description: This creative and challenging Leadership Development Workshop has been specifically designed to meet the diverse needs of those working for children and young people across the cultural sector and children's workforce. Combining leadership theory, action-based learning, a touch of behavioural psychology and some insightful facilitation, these workshops provide an excellent environment for participants to build a fuller understanding of their own leadership. All are welcome to apply.
